If you are a user of some Microsoft operating systems, surely you already know the importance of the taskbar. This is where you will find access to the start menu, Windows search, the system tray, the clock, activity and notification center, the shortcuts to the pinned programs, cortana and the programs that you currently have open.
Without a doubt, the Windows 10 taskbar is one of the most important elements of the system since it is the one that does not facilitate access to practically any place in the operating system. This taskbar is highly customizable since, being an element so used by the user, Microsoft allows them to customize it practically completely.

How to resize the Windows 10 taskbar:
– The first thing you will have to do is right-click on the taskbar.
– When the drop-down menu is shown you must make sure to UNMARK the option: Lock all taskbars.
– Now you will have to place your mouse cursor on the outer edge of the task bar. This will cause the cursor to change to an icon with two opposite arrows.
– Click and hold and drag the edge of the taskbar until it reaches the desired size.
– Finally, we will have to right-click with the mouse on the taskbar so that when the drop-down menu is displayed, re-MARK the option: Block all taskbars (this will prevent subsequent accidental modifications).
– Ready from now on you will use your operating system with the custom taskbar size.
